Top Virtual Pet Apps on iOS in Brazil: Q1 2025 Performance
Discover the performance trends of the top virtual pet apps on iOS in Brazil during Q1 2025, highlighting downloads, revenue, and active user metrics.
In the first quarter of 2025, the virtual pet app category on iOS in Brazil saw varied performance across the top applications. Here’s a look at how these apps fared in terms of downloads, revenue, and active users.
Dog & Puppy, Vet Game for Kids experienced a decline in both revenue and downloads over the quarter. Revenue started at approximately $1.3K in early January and gradually decreased to about $874 by the end of March. Downloads also fell from around 1.5K to 475 during the same period. Weekly active users showed a slight decrease from 9.8K to 8.3K.
Cat & Kitty, Vet Game for Kids maintained a relatively steady revenue stream, peaking at $1.1K in early March before tapering to $758 by the end of the quarter. Downloads followed a downward trend from 1.5K to 313, while active users decreased from 6.7K to 7K, marking some fluctuations throughout the quarter.
My Cat – Virtual Pet Games showed an interesting revenue pattern, starting at $782, peaking at $1.5K in early March, and then dropping to $367 by the end of the month. Downloads fluctuated, beginning at 3.6K and ending at 735. Active users saw a notable drop from 7.6K to 4.6K during this period.
Slime Pet: ASMR Virtual Friend experienced a decline in revenue from $621 to $321. Downloads were minimal, starting at 65 and dropping to zero by mid-quarter, with no active user data available.
Lastly, Baby Panda World - BabyBus saw a slight increase in revenue, from $496 to $525 by the end of March, despite fluctuating download numbers that started at 760 and ended at 290. Active users showed an initial increase, peaking at 2.3K, before stabilizing around 1.4K.
